How Our Team Performs Rapid Structural Drying
When water damage strikes, every minute counts. That’s why our team follows a precise process to ensure the job is done right the first time. We start by ass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to dry your home’s structural elements – walls, floors, and ceilings – as quickly and efficiently as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ify areas of concern. We then develop a customized plan to dry your home’s structural elements, taking into account the type and extent of the damage.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Activation
We deploy our advanced drying equipment, including desiccants, dehumidifiers, and fans, to start the drying process. Our technicians monitor the equipment and adjust as needed to ensure best performance.
Step 3: Monitoring and Adjustments
Our team continuously monitors the drying process, making adjustments as necessary to ensure the job is completed efficiently and effectively. We also communicate regularly with you to keep you informed of our progress.
Step 4: Final Drying and Inspection
Once the drying process is complete, we conduct a thorough inspection to ensure your home’s structural elements are dry and safe. We also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ining our findings and recommendations for any further work.

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ying
Water damage can be sneaky, and it’s essential to catch the warning signs early to prevent costly repairs. Keep an eye out for these common indicators: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ture buildup. Don’t ignore these smells – they can show a more significant problem lurking beneath the surface.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Water damage can cause floors to warp or buckle, compromising the structural integrity of your home. Don’t wait for the damage to spread – act now to prevent further deterioration.
Visible Water Stains or Leaks
Water stains or leaks can be a sign of a more significant issue. Don’t ignore these signs – they can show a burst pipe, overflowing appliance, or other water damage-related problem.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up. Don’t ignore these signs – they can show a more significant problem lurking beneath the surface.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ks can be a sign of structural compromise. Don’t ignore these signs – they can show a more significant problem that needs immediate attention.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Clemmons, NC
The cost of Rapid Structural Drying services in Clemmons, NC, can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small water damage area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area, type of damage, and equipment needed |
| Medium water damage area (100-500 sq. Ft.) | $2,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of damage, and equipment needed |
| Large water damage area (over 500 sq. Ft.) | $5,000 – $10,000 | Size of the affected area, type of damage, and equipment needed |
|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under floors) | $1,000 – $3,000 | Difficulty of access, equipment needed, and time required |
| Structural element repair or replacement | $2,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, type of repair or replacement needed, and labor costs |
| More services (e.g., mold remediation, contents cleaning) |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, type of service needed, and equipment required |

Common Questions About Rapid Structural Drying
Q: What is Rapid Structural Drying?
Rapid Structural Drying is a specialized service designed to dry structural elements quickly and efficiently, reducing downtime and preventing costly repairs.
Q: How long does the drying process take?
The drying process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ity and size of the affected area.
Q: Will I need to replace my flooring or walls?
Not always. In some cases, our technicians can dry and restore your flooring and walls to their original condition.
Q: Will I need to move out of my home during the drying process?
It dep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In some cases, it may be necessary to vacate the premises temporarily.
Q: Is Rapid Structural Drying covered by insurance?
Yes, many insurance policies cover Rapid Structural Drying services. We’ll work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.
